Understanding Dependency

 

Dependency is an intricate condition that impacts the brain's structure and function. The interaction of organic, mental, and ecological aspects plays a considerable role in addiction growth and persistence.

 

The Science of Addiction

 

Dependency alters brain chemistry, specifically impacting natural chemicals like dopamine. This neurotransmitter is vital for satisfaction and reward. Over time, substance use can cause changes in brain wiring, making it harder for individuals to experience joy without the substance.

 

Research studies reveal that hereditary predisposition additionally contributes to addiction, with family history frequently suggesting a greater danger. Ecological impacts, such as anxiety and direct exposure to compound usage, further exacerbate vulnerability. Efficient dependency treatment in Albany includes this understanding, focusing on both biological and mental dimensions.

 

Treatment approaches objective to recover equilibrium in brain function and address behavioral patterns. Evidence-based treatments, like cognitive behavior modification (CBT), are vital in assisting individuals build dealing techniques and resilience versus triggers.

 

Typical Misunderstandings

 

Lots of misunderstandings border addiction, one being that it is only a moral failing. In truth, addiction is a persistent disease, similar to diabetes or heart disease. This misconception typically results in preconception, which can prevent people from looking for aid.

 

One more misunderstanding is that dependency only refers to materials like drugs or alcohol. Behavior dependencies, such as gambling or video gaming, can be just as damaging. These behaviors can trigger the same benefit paths in the mind, leading to compulsive actions regardless of adverse repercussions.

 

Furthermore, there is an idea that recuperation just involves abstaining from the habit forming material. Actually, lasting recuperation frequently needs holistic techniques that consist of therapy, support system, and lifestyle modifications. By dealing with both physical and mental elements, people can achieve long-term recovery from addiction.

The Healing Trip

 

The healing trip entails a series of stages and realistic expectation administration that help individuals efficiently browse their path to addiction freedom. Comprehending these components develops a framework for enduring adjustment.

 

Stages of Healing

 

Recuperation is often defined in distinctive stages:

 


  1. Precontemplation: Individuals might not identify their substance use as an issue. Recognition is reduced, and change is not considered.


  2. Reflection: At this phase, people recognize the concern and start to contemplate making a change, weighing benefits and drawbacks.


  3. Preparation: People begin planning how to change. This may consist of looking into treatment choices or developing an assistance network.


  4. Activity: Energetic actions are required to attend to addiction, such as entering rehab or attending support system.


  5. Upkeep: Individuals work to sustain their recuperation and stay clear of regression. This stage typically includes continuous self-improvement and assistance.

Comprehending Methadone Treatment

 

Methadone therapy functions as a medication-assisted option for those dealing with opioid reliance. This approach includes the administration of methadone, a long-acting opioid agonist, which decreases cravings and withdrawal signs and symptoms.

 

Methadone treatment is typically given through accredited clinics, where individuals receive day-to-day doses under supervision. This structured technique helps to stabilize their lives, allowing them to concentrate on recuperation and therapy.

 

It's important for individuals to understand that methadone must become part of a detailed treatment plan, that includes counseling and assistance solutions to address the underlying problems of dependency.

 

Inpatient vs. Outpatient Treatment

 

Inpatient care offers day-and-night assistance in a domestic setting, making it an excellent choice for serious addiction situations. People benefit from continuous access to doctor and restorative tasks, promoting a much deeper degree of involvement with the recovery procedure.

 

Outpatient treatment, on the other hand, permits people to keep some facets of their day-to-day live while going to scheduled treatment sessions. This model provides flexibility and may be suitable for those with less extreme dependencies or as a step-down from inpatient therapy.

 

Each choice has its advantages and must be selected based on the individual's circumstances, therapy objectives, and offered support systems.

 

 

Maintaining Soberness

 

Preserving sobriety requires a mix of efficient methods and considerable lifestyle adjustments. Carrying out positive measures can aid stop relapse and assistance long lasting recuperation.

 

Fall Back Prevention Approaches

 

Determining triggers is essential for regression prevention. Triggers can consist of certain settings, relationships, or moods that provoke the wish to use materials. Preserving a thorough journal regarding sensations and situations can assist recognize these patterns.

 

Establishing coping approaches is another vital aspect. Methods such as mindfulness reflection, deep breathing exercises, and support groups give individuals with tools to handle cravings efficiently. Developing a solid support network is vital. Routinely getting in touch with friends, household, or recuperation teams cultivates accountability and motivation.
